Understanding Spotify Device Pairing

Spotify device pairing is the process of connecting your various gadgets to your Spotify account, allowing you to control playback and enjoy music across multiple devices. This feature goes beyond the traditional method of playing music through Bluetooth, offering a more integrated and efficient experience. By pairing your devices with Spotify, you unlock a range of benefits that contribute to a more harmonious music-streaming journey.

Spotify Connect: Taking Device Pairing to the Next Level

While device pairing is impressive, Spotify takes it a step further with Spotify Connect. Connect is a feature that allows you to control playback on one device using another, provided they are connected to the same Wi-Fi network. This eliminates the need for Bluetooth pairing and offers more seamless control.

  1. How to Remotely Log Out of a Connected Device?

Visit the Spotify website, log in to your account, go to the “Account Overview” section, and select “Sign Out Everywhere” to log out of all connected devices.
